My Big Black Loco with Tender, plus my light set arrived late yesterday. The
light set consists of a standard train light brick, a sliver reflector, an
ordinary 1x2 black brick, a 9v cable (20cm?) and instructions on how to
build it into all of the new Locos.

A pleasant surprise: the set is designed to replace the single light on top
of the boiler (and uses the two smallest 'plate' stickers from the Loco's
sticker set to disguise the light brick). The instructions get you to remove
the rod from the left side of the boiler and run the cable along the top of
the boiler, through the two clips and in through the front window hole on
the cab, then it doubles back under the boiler. I didn't particularly like
this design (but that's the beauty of Lego - you can change it so easily) so
I replaced one of the 1x2 slopes on top of the boiler with a 1x1 brick to
make a hole directly behind the smoke stack, and created a passage straight
down through the boiler. The supplied cable was now far too long, so I
replaced it with a 10cm one from my Mindstorms set.

This allowed me room to customise the inside of the cab, and to fit the
motor at the rear of the Loco (as opposed to the front as per the instructions).

If you've got plenty of lights, I don't think the light set is worth it, so
I'll see if I can post a scan of the light instructions, and some pics of my
customised Loco on the net in the next few days.
